TURN-208: Gatevale turnstile counters at the Merrow Field pilot double-count when a rotation reverses mid-cycle. Attendance totals drift roughly 2% high per event. The debounce window fix is implemented, reviewed by Ilsa, and soak-tested across two simulated match days without drift. Ready for your cut; the candidate build is identified below.

trace token, tagag-tafog: htk6_5ed18c

All release binaries for the Resizely batch image-resizing CLI are signed before publication to the Thornbeck package mirror. The build pipeline computes digests for each platform target, then signs the combined manifest in an isolated signing stage with no network egress. Verification is mandatory on install; the CLI refuses to self-update from unsigned manifests. Key rotation occurs quarterly and is logged in the security register. For reviewer confirmation, the signing key currently used by the release pipeline is reproduced below.

signing key of kahog-kadup = bky13_6wLyxnPsJob4P

# TileVault Environments

TileVault is the tile-rendering cache layer in front of the Ordmere map renderer. There are three environments: dev, staging, and prod. Support should note that eviction policies and TTLs differ per environment, so a tile appearing stale in prod may render fine in staging. For reference when triaging cache tickets, the prod environment runs with the following configuration.

service settings:
[silwyn]
host = silwyn.crelvogrid.internal
user = silwyn_svc
database = silwyn_prod

## Changelog — Wrenfield Gateway v4.2.0

### Changed defaults: health checks

Health-check defaults behind the Tolliver load balancer have changed. The interval is shorter, the unhealthy threshold is stricter, and checks now hit the dedicated readiness endpoint instead of the root path. Services that were slow to report ready will be drained faster than before, so verify startup timing before promoting this release. All environments upgraded to v4.2.0 will pick up the following configuration values:

service settings:
[briius]
port = 3000
region = outer-1
host = briius.zarqeldyn.internal
team = wenael
timeout_ms = 2000
retries = 5